As VIVO Pro Kabaddi Season 5 approaches the 50-match mark, the action on the digital space has also reached a new high. After the Ahmedabad leg, new teams and new players have arrived to set social media abuzz. With over 1.2 million fans on Facebook, 1.6 lakh fans on Twitter and almost 45,000 fans on Instagram, here’s a look at the team and players who have got the highest mentions on social media in Week 3.

Top Teams

Tamil Thalaivas’ maiden VIVO Pro Kabaddi campaign is off to a disappointing start as they presently languish at the bottom of Zone B points table but this has not affected their popularity as they have risen from the third spot in Week 2 to occupy the pole position. Gujarat Fortunegiants, on the other hand, have had a dream start to their maiden campaign with an undefeated home leg in Ahmedabad with five wins and one tie. This has guaranteed them a second place in Week 3’s fan engagement rankings.

Patna Pirates, double defending champions, continue to be one of the hot-properties on social media as they have jumped a rung from fourth to third. They are followed by Bengaluru Bulls, who have come down from the highest position to fourth, and Nitin Tomar’s U.P. Yoddha at fifth.

Top Players

After Week 3, Patna Pirates captain and ‘Dubki King’ Pardeep Narwal has snatched the pole position from Bengaluru Bulls captain Rohit Kumar, who held it after Week 2. The ‘Most Valuable Player’ of Season 4 has been a complete beast on the mat this season as well. He has also created a new VIVO Pro Kabaddi record by picking up 19 points in a single match, the maximum by any player. Rohit is now second in the popularity list.

Tamil Thalaivas captain Ajay Thakur, meanwhile, has risen to third and it’s no surprise considering his recent form. The fourth position has a surprise entrant in the form of Patna Pirates’ Monu Goyat, who has been his team’s second best raider after the effervescent Pardeep Narwal. U Mumba ‘Captain Cool’ Anup Kumar now sits at fifth, having fallen from third after Week 2.
